Introducing the Frenzy II model, a knife that combines style and functionality in one sleek design. With its two-tone black and blue G-10 handle and satin finished blade, this knife is sure to catch your eye. Inspired by the Japanese Kabutowari knife, the Frenzy series offers a large blade with a modified sheepsfoot shape. The thick spine, slender grind, piercing point, and long flat cutting edge make it perfect for a variety of tasks. Crafted with 3D machined G-10 handles and a tough blade made from CPM-S35VN steel, this knife is built to last. Designed by Andrew Demko, the Frenzy II is the ideal everyday carry knife that you'll want by your side.
Specifications
Blade Steel: Cpm S 35 Vn
Model Number: 62 P 2 A
Lock Type: Safety
Blade Thickness: 0.13 inches
Handle Thickness: 0.51 inches
Blade Length: 5.5 inches
Open Length: 12.25 inches
Close Length: 6.75 inches
Weight: 5.58 ounces
Blade Edge: Plain
Finish Color: Satin
Style: Sheepsfoot
Clip Type: Tip Up
Clip Position: Tip Up
Handle Material: Fiberglass
Use Case: EDC
Origin: Taiwan
